You are booking hotel for more than 30 days

Review Of Sables d'Or Luxury Apartments0123401234

Mahe, Mahe

    User Rating & Reviews

    Popular Areas in Mahe

    Four Star Hotels in Mahe

    Premium Hotels in Mahe